data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
1
+ [![Stories in Ready](https://badge.waffle.io/enilsen16/eefgilm.png?label=ready&title=Ready)](https://waffle.io/enilsen16/eefgilm)
2
+ #Eefgilm: A gem for cleaning up your Gemfile
3
+
4
+ #Description:
5
+ This gem automatically sorts the Gemfile alphabetically and removes comments, per Best Practice. Grouped gems are only sorted within their group.
6
+
7
+
8
+ ## Installation
9
+
10
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
11
+
12
+ gem 'eefgilm'
13
+
14
+ And then execute:
15
+
16
+ $ bundle
17
+
18
+ Or install it yourself as:
19
+
20
+ $ gem install eefgilm
21
+

@@ -0,0 +1,71 @@
1
+ module Eefgilm
2
+ class Gemfile
3
+ attr_accessor :path, :lines, :source, :group
4
+
5
+ def initialize(path = ".", options = {})
6
+ @path = path
7
+ @lines = []
8
+ @options = {
9
+ :alphabetize => true,
10
+ :delete_whitespace => true,
11
+ :delete_comments => true
12
+ }.merge(options)
13
+ end
14
+
15
+ def clean!
16
+ # Extract:
17
+ extract_to_array_of_lines
18
+
19
+ # Transform:
20
+ delete_comments! if @options[:delete_comments]
21
+ delete_whitespace! if @options[:delete_whitespace]
22
+ alphabetize_gems! if @options[:alphabetize]
23
+
24
+ # Load:
25
+ recreate_file
26
+ end
27
+
28
+ private
29
+
30
+ def extract_to_array_of_lines
31
+ gemfile = File.open("#{@path}/Gemfile", "r+")
32
+
33
+ file_lines = gemfile.readlines
34
+ file_lines.each do |line|
35
+ self.source = line if line.match(/^source/)
36
+ group = line.match(//) if line.match(/^\s*group/)
37
+ self.lines << line if line.match(/^\s*gem/)
38
+ end
39
+ end
40
+
41
+ def delete_comments!
42
+ @lines.each do |string|
43
+ string.gsub!(/#(.*)$/, "")
44
+ end
45
+ end
46
+
47
+ def recreate_file
48
+ output = File.open( "#{@path}/Gemfile", "w+" )
49
+ output.puts @source
50
+ output.puts
51
+
52
+ @lines.each do |line|
53
+ unless line.empty?
54
+ output.puts line
55
+ end
56
+ end
57
+
58
+ output.close
59
+ end
60
+
61
+ def alphabetize_gems!
62
+ @lines.sort!
63
+ end
64
+
65
+ def delete_whitespace!
66
+ @lines.each do |line|
67
+ line.gsub!(/(?<=^|\[)\s+|\s+(?=$|\])|(?<=\s)\s+/, "")
68
+ end
69
+ end
70
+ end
71
+ end
